I got an Apple TV 3 for Christmas last year and I have it hooked up to a 55" Plasma HDTV. I've noticed that when I use it to watch movies (on Netflix, iTunes streaming, or otherwise), the screen will black out randomly. It usually takes about 5 or 10 seconds for the screen to come back on. What's weird is the movie continues playing while the screen is blacked out.

I unplugged the power and HDMI from the ATV and also disconnected the HDMI cable from the TV. I let it sit for a minute and plugged everything back in. It stopped the blackouts for a good amount of time but it started up again nonetheless. The blackouts are completely random and sometimes they'll happen one right after another. It's extremely annoying and I have no idea what's causing it.

Is it a problem with the Apple TV or does it sound like a problem with my TV? I'm able to pause the movie/TV show I'm watching while it blacks out, so the ATV is still functional. I'm going to call Apple tomorrow but I figured I check here first to see if it's even an issue with the Apple TV. Thanks!

Do you have another TV and/or HDMI Cable to try it out?

Does this symptom happen with any other video source such as cable?

If you are able to pause it does sound like a problem with your TV. However it could very well be a video hardware failure on the ATV. You need to isolate the problem to figure out exactly which component is displaying the blackout.
